Pothos (Epipremnum aureum) is a tropical vine known as one of the most resilient and popular houseplants globally. Often called Devil’s Ivy for its hardiness and ability to thrive even in low light, this plant is characterized by its glossy, heart-shaped leaves and lengthy, trailing stems. New owners frequently ask how quickly it will fill a space. The growth rate depends on specific conditions that govern the plant’s metabolic activity.
Understanding the Pothos Growth Timeline
A Pothos plant exhibits a growth pattern that is highly dependent on the season and the environment it is placed in. Under typical indoor conditions, the plant’s growth is moderate but consistent, with the potential for rapid spurts when conditions are optimized. The active growing season occurs during the warmer months, generally spanning from mid-spring through early fall.
During peak activity, a well-cared-for Pothos can add between 12 to 18 inches of vine length monthly, especially in tropical or greenhouse settings. In the average home, a more conservative growth rate is typical, but the plant still produces significant new foliage during spring and summer. As a tropical species, Pothos conserves energy when light levels and temperatures drop. Growth significantly slows down or enters a near-dormant state during the cooler days of late fall and winter.
The plant also progresses through distinct life stages that affect its speed and appearance. Juvenile Pothos, which are the most common form sold as houseplants, have small to medium-sized, heart-shaped leaves and demonstrate explosive growth as they establish their root systems. As the plant matures and begins to climb a vertical structure, its growth rate often remains high, and its leaves can dramatically increase in size, a phenomenon called maturation. This shift from small, trailing leaves to larger foliage is a response to the plant sensing an upward trajectory toward better light.
Key Environmental Factors That Accelerate or Slow Growth
The primary factor determining how fast a Pothos grows is the intensity and duration of the light it receives. While the plant tolerates low light environments, its metabolic machinery for growth is maximized in bright, indirect light conditions. Insufficient light forces the plant to conserve energy, resulting in significantly slower growth and a “leggy” appearance as the stems stretch out between leaves in search of a light source. Providing at least six to eight hours of consistent, bright ambient light will maximize the plant’s photosynthetic capacity, thereby accelerating the production of new leaves and stems.
Water availability is another element, as the movement of nutrients and the turgidity of plant cells depend on consistent hydration. Pothos prefer to dry out slightly between waterings; a good practice is to wait until the top one or two inches of soil feel dry to the touch before re-watering. Overwatering is a common mistake that starves the roots of oxygen, leading to root rot, which severely stunts growth and can eventually kill the plant. Conversely, chronic underwatering causes the plant to enter a survival mode, slowing all growth to conserve its limited resources.
The surrounding atmosphere also plays a role, as humidity encourages the development of aerial roots along the vines. Pothos thrive in humidity levels between 40 to 60%, though 70 to 80% can further boost vine growth speed. Temperature is a direct regulator of the plant’s metabolism, with the optimal range for peak activity being between 70°F and 90°F. Providing a balanced liquid fertilizer every four to six weeks during the spring and summer supplies the necessary nutrients for vigorous stem and leaf extension.
Observing and Managing Pothos Growth
Tracking the growth rate of a Pothos is most easily done by observing the vine tips for new leaf unfurling and periodically measuring the longest runners from the base of the pot. A simple method involves marking a reference point and noting the distance of a specific node at the start of the active season. The appearance of new, vibrant leaves indicates that the plant is healthy and actively growing.
Pruning is an effective management tool that influences the plant’s growth distribution rather than its overall speed. Strategic trimming of the longest vines redirects the plant’s energy, which often encourages the growth of new shoots closer to the base, resulting in a fuller, bushier appearance. When pruning, making a clean cut just below a leaf node allows the remaining stem to branch out, promoting density.
The direction of growth can also be manipulated to achieve different results. Allowing the vines to trail from a hanging basket is a common display method, but it typically results in smaller leaves. Conversely, training the Pothos to climb a support structure, such as a moss pole, allows its aerial roots to anchor. This signals the plant to produce larger, more substantial leaves and thicker stems, mimicking its natural tropical habit and often resulting in a visually faster-growing specimen.
